5.2.10 Load variation suppression function
This function uses the disturbance torque determined by the disturbance observer to reduce effect of
disturbance torque and vibration.
This is effective when Real-time auto tuning cannot handle load variation sufficiently.
Applicable range
This function can be applicable only when the following conditions are satisfied.
Conditions under which the disturbance observer is activated:
Position control, Velocity control or Full-closed control
Should be in servo-on condition
Parameters except for controls such as torque limit setup, are correctly set, assuring that the motor can run smoothly.
Caution
Effect may not be expected in the following condition.
Conditions which obstruct disturbance observer action:
The rigidity is low (the anti-resonance point is at low frequency range of 10 Hz or below)
The load shows a clear non-linear trend with friction and backlash.
